摘要
Paint flow rate flux through the spray gun is one of the basic variables required to model the spray painting process and to predict the paint thickness distribution on the surface to be painted. This nonuniform flux distribution within the spray cone causes a nonuniform coating thickness distribution on the painted surface. A direct approach is used to model the flow rate flux and the flow rate flux causing the measured distribution is determined. The method uses experimental paint thickness distribution resulting from a single painting stroke applied on a flat surface.
